Todd Stephens <tbstep at tampabay.rr.com> writes:
> I have everything configured (so I thought) to use the cd-rw drive as a
> normal user. As a normal user, I can mount a data cd just fine, but
> when I try to run cdda2wav to record an audio cd as a user, I get a
> permission denied error. I checked the cdda2wav binary and the
> permissions on it are 555, so I should be able to execute the binary as
> a user. Permissions on the relative devices (cd0a and cd0c and the
> rcd* devices) are all 644 root:operator. What else needs to be done
> here?
Some guesses: xpt(4)? pass(4)?
If I recall correctly, cdda2wav should tell you in the error message.
It may need to have a verbosity level kicked up first...
